Amp Envelope Question
Does anyone know of a way to make the amp envelope not affect the sound? I'm asking this because you can disengage the filter envelope from the filter. That way, you can use the filter envelope as a modulator in the matrix.
That's fine as far as it goes, but sometimes I want the filter envelope to modulate the filter but I don't need an amp envelope. I would love to have that amp envelope as an optional modulator. Thanks for your help. |

On the Korg "Moss" system on the Z1/Trinity/Triton, there are four LFOs and four EGs. They're not tied to anything. You can assign them to whatever you want, no restrictions whatsoever.
Then there's also another Amp EG, too, which can be also used as a modulation source. I wish the Virus had that lot.
